Xintian Technology Shares to Halt Trading From July 27 on Control Transfer Review
2026-07-24 11:22:42
Xintian Technology said its controlling shareholder and actual controller, Shi Weiping, is planning a transfer of the company shares he holds, an arrangement that could lead to a change in control, according to Jiemian News. The company said the parties are still discussing the transaction structure, price and agreement terms, and that the final terms will depend on the signed documents. Xintian Technology has applied to the Shenzhen Stock Exchange to suspend trading in its shares from the open on July 27, 2026, with the suspension expected to last no more than two trading days.
